There are traditions in Manaqib Al Abi Talib, vol 2, p 135; al-Burhan fi tafsir al-Qur'an, vol 3, p 578 and Bihar al-anwar vol 38, p 76 to the effect that Imam Ali (as) climbed on the shoulders of the Prophet (saw) to destroy the idol hubl (which was the biggest of the idols).

Below is one of the traditions in Manaqib Al Abi Talib:

Quran is challenging the idol worshippers ( Did you see Allaat and Ozza and Manaat) which are three famous idols worshipped by them, that they can never help you or any one. So, mentioning the names of these three idols was to challenge the idol worshippers and condemn idol worshipping. Some scholars suggest that it might be a hint for Muslims who will blindly follow three persons like worshipping them, as they will never help them in this life and hereafter and warn from the harm of such blind following of such wrong leaders.
